The Location
Set along the desirable Briggate, a quiet and well-regarded corner of North Walsham, this home enjoys a setting that perfectly balances privacy with convenience. Known for its established feel and attractive surroundings, Briggate is ideally placed for making the most of everything this thriving market town has to offer.
North Walsham itself is celebrated for its strong community spirit, rich heritage, and welcoming atmosphere. Everyday life is made effortless, with supermarkets, independent shops, cafés, and a leisure centre complete with gym and swimming pool all close at hand.
Families benefit from a choice of well-regarded primary and secondary schools, while commuters are well served by the town’s railway station, offering direct links to Norwich and onward connections to London.
Beyond the town, the great outdoors awaits. From scenic Norfolk countryside and the tranquil waterways of the Norfolk Broads to the coast just a short drive away, sandy beaches, big skies, and timeless landscapes are all within easy reach, offering the very best of both vibrant town living and the serenity of nature.
White Horse Lane, Briggate
White Cottage is a beautifully presented and surprisingly spacious home, tucked away in the heart of North Walsham. From the road, the white rendered frontage gives little away, creating a charming and understated first impression that belies the generous accommodation found within.
A private driveway provides off-road parking, adding everyday convenience to this characterful cottage.
Accessed through a gate, the garden immediately sets the tone for the privacy and calm this property offers. The entrance to the home is positioned to the rear, enhancing the sense of seclusion. Here you’ll find terracotta-coloured paving thoughtfully laid to create an inviting dining and seating area, perfect for outdoor entertaining. Beyond this, a well-maintained lawn is fully enclosed, offering an excellent degree of privacy, along with a great sense of space.
The garden is complemented by the added benefit of a garage, making it both practical and appealing.
Stepping inside via the porch entrance, you are welcomed into the kitchen, a warm and functional space fitted with neutral units and complemented by white painted beams overhead, which add character without overpowering the room. There is ample space for appliances, and the layout flows naturally, with one door opening to reveal the staircase and another leading through to the dining room.
The dining room continues the cottage’s cosy yet airy feel, again featuring white beams that echo the home’s traditional charm. A multi-fuel burner sits comfortably within the room, creating a welcoming focal point and making this an ideal space for both everyday meals and relaxed evenings. From here, a large opening leads through to the sitting room, enhancing the sense of openness while still retaining clearly defined living areas.
The sitting room is bright and inviting, with French doors opening directly onto the garden and a window overlooking the outdoor space, allowing natural light to flood in and creating a strong connection between inside and out. It’s a room perfectly suited to unwinding, entertaining, or simply enjoying the peaceful garden outlook.
Upstairs, the cottage continues to impress with two well-proportioned bedrooms, both reflecting the neutral, cosy tones found throughout the property. These rooms feel calm and comfortable, ideal for rest and relaxation. Completing the upper floor is a modern, super-stylish shower room, thoughtfully updated to offer contemporary comfort while fitting seamlessly with the character of the home.
Overall, White Cottage is a modernised, much-loved home that blends charm, privacy and practicality with ease. Deceptive in size and beautifully maintained, it offers a wonderful opportunity to enjoy stylish cottage living in a convenient North Walsham location.
